SciELO - Scientific Electronic Library Online

vol.16 issue31A Two-Class Bayesian Classifier to Select the Best Priority Rule in a Job Shop: Open Shop Scheduling ProblemElectronic properties of an elliptical quantum ring with rectangular cross section (Elliptical quantum ring) author indexsubject indexarticles search
Home Pagealphabetic serial listing  

Services on Demand



Related links

  • On index processCited by Google
  • Have no similar articlesSimilars in SciELO
  • On index processSimilars in Google


Revista EIA

Print version ISSN 1794-1237
On-line version ISSN 2463-0950


SOLARTE PABON, Oswaldo  and  VILLEGAS, Liliana Esther Machuca. Fostering Motivation and Improving Student Performance in an Introductory Programming Course: An Integrated Teaching Approach. Rev.EIA.Esc.Ing.Antioq [online]. 2019, vol.16, n.31, pp.65-76. ISSN 1794-1237.

This paper expands a teaching proposal presented at the Innovation and Technology in Computer Science Education Conference, in 2016. The proposal provides an integrated teaching approach for improving students' performance in a first programming course. The approach is based on four main components: the use of Python as first programming language, project-oriented and problem-based learning, multimedia resources, and assessment rubrics. Material and learning resources for the course development are available on virtual platforms. Our findings suggest that the approach enhanced students' academic performance, as can be seen in their grades, as well as a decrease in dropout rates.

Keywords : Introductory programming course; Teaching approach; Python; Project-oriented and problem-based learning.

        · abstract in Spanish | Portuguese     · text in Spanish     · Spanish ( pdf )